Bunk Beds

Bunk beds are a tried-and-true way to maximize space in a bedroom. They are perfect for homes with a limited area and are the perfect choice for holiday rental properties. Bunk beds can be a fun choice for kids bedrooms. They can add a fun element to the décor.

There are many different types of bunk beds It is therefore important to choose the one that is most suitable for your needs. You will have to decide if you would like ladders or stairs to get to the top bunk. Ladders are classic, but stairs can be more secure and multi-functional. For instance, they can include drawers to provide extra storage.

Another factor to consider when choosing the best bunk bed is how much privacy you require between the two sleeping areas. An l shaped single beds-shaped bunk bed is a good option if you have children of similar in age and sharing the bedroom. It gives each child an individual sleeping space, while preserving the floor space. If you're considering adding a bunk that has an additional twist, think about one that has trundle capability. They come with an extra mattress that can be removed in the event that you require a third bed, and then put away when no longer required. This is a great solution for guests who want to stay over for extended periods or for teens who prefer to host sleepovers with their friends.

Another great choice for older kids is the high-rise bunk. They have twin beds up high and a large bed underneath, which provides plenty of space for both adults and children. High-rise bunks are a great option for teens who wish to maintain a spacious space in their bedroom and are ideal for college students who reside in dorm rooms. A lot of our high-rise bunks have a desk or study space under the lower bed. This is a great area for homework and projects.

High Sleeper

High sleepers (also called loft beds) are a stylish option for bedrooms for children. They maximize space as they elevate the sleeping area. They also have a multi-functional design that can be used for storage, study or leisure. They are perfect for smaller rooms as the sleeping space takes up less area than a traditional single bed and often feature stairs that slide into the frame for a seamless look. A lot of the Stompa high sleeper collections can be paired with other elements to create a practical solution for your child's bedroom including sofa beds, desks and wardrobes.

High sleeper beds are bigger than mid sleepers and can feel more imposing in small rooms. The extra height is to be used in larger bedrooms. Children can also personalise the space by putting furniture in it that they pick. Many designs include desks, such as the Kids Avenue Noah Gaming Highsleeper that can be adapted to a variety of themes in the decor and can fit up to three monitors to provide an amazing gaming experience.

Many of our high-sleepers also have a pull-out sofa bed that can be used as an additional bed during the time of a sleepover. This makes them a perfect option for kids who regularly invite their friends over. Combining this with shelves or chests of drawers can ensure that your child's bedroom is free of clutter.

Are high-sleepers safe?

High and mid sleeper beds are designed to ensure safety. As long as you follow assembly instructions and keep your sleeping space free of any objects, they should be just as secure as other types of beds. A rug should be placed underneath the high-sleeper mattress of your child to ensure a safe landing in the event of falling. This will reduce the risk that they suffer serious injuries. It is also essential to leave enough space between the ceiling and top of the bed in order to avoid bumps when climbing the ladder.
